Joep,  I have a few questions on your plans for a 0.22 release of Hadoop.  Are 
you planning on releasing a version of 0.8 Pig that works with 0.22?  I would 
suggest working with 0.9 or trunk instead since a number of significant 
features that your users will find useful (macros, python embedding, works with 
HCatalog, etc.) have been added.  You are of course free to pursue whichever 
branch you prefer.

Also, I'm curious how you plan to test this release.  I think it would be 
really good if you could get the end-to-end tests running against this before 
releasing it to assure you have adequate test coverage.

> Currently Pig depends on hadoop 0.20.
> While it is relatively easy to pass a property to the build (through -D or 
> through build.properties) to set hadoop-core.version to something else, the 
> problem is that since hadoop 0.22 the project has been split.
> No longer is there one single hadoop-core jar to build against.
